Salads are often seen as the “fresh, eat-it-now” meal, but what if you could make your favorite salads in advance and still enjoy them just as much the next day? These 21 salads are designed to hold up in the fridge without getting soggy, keeping their flavor and crunch.

Whether you’re meal prepping or planning ahead for a busy week, these salads will stay delicious and satisfying. From hearty grain-based dishes to fresh, vibrant greens, you can make them today and love them tomorrow.

Quinoa and roasted veggies come together in this make-ahead salad that actually improves after a day or two.

Roast your favorite vegetables—think sweet potatoes, carrots, and bell peppers—and mix them with cooked quinoa.

Toss in a light lemon dressing and some feta for creaminess.

The quinoa acts as a great base, absorbing all the flavors, while the veggies stay tender yet firm, even the next day.

This bright, refreshing salad is packed with protein from chickpeas and crunch from cucumbers.

Combine chickpeas, diced cucumbers, red onions, and parsley.

A simple dressing of olive oil, lemon juice, and garlic is all you need.

It stays fresh and crunchy, with the flavors melding over time, making it perfect for a make-ahead meal.

Orzo is a small, pasta-like grain that pairs beautifully with Mediterranean ingredients.

Mix orzo with kalamata olives, cherry tomatoes, cucumbers, red onion, and feta cheese.

A tangy dressing of olive oil, lemon, and oregano brings everything together.

The orzo absorbs the dressing, but the salad stays fresh and vibrant even after sitting in the fridge.

Kale is known for its hearty texture, which makes it perfect for a salad that can sit in the fridge.

Toss chopped kale with thinly sliced apples, walnuts, and a drizzle of honey mustard dressing.

The kale’s fibrous texture won’t wilt, and the apples stay crisp, making this salad a great choice for meal prepping.

Lentils are a great make-ahead ingredient because they’re hearty and stay firm.

Combine cooked lentils with roasted tomatoes, red onion, and arugula.

A tangy dressing of olive oil and red wine vinegar adds brightness.

This salad can be made a day ahead, and it actually improves as the lentils soak up the flavors.

Broccoli stays crisp even after being prepped ahead of time, making this salad a winner.

Mix blanched broccoli florets with crispy bacon, red onion, and sunflower seeds.

A creamy dressing made with mayo, vinegar, and sugar adds the perfect tang.

It’s a delicious combination of crunchy, savory, and creamy that stays fresh for days.

Tabbouleh is a refreshing salad made with bulgur, parsley, tomatoes, and mint.

This Middle Eastern classic is perfect for making in advance, as the flavors only get better over time.

A squeeze of lemon juice and a drizzle of olive oil complete this herbaceous, light salad.

Panzanella is a Tuscan bread salad that’s made with tomatoes, cucumbers, onions, and crusty bread.

The bread soaks up all the juices, and it only gets better the longer it sits.

Toss everything together with olive oil, vinegar, and herbs, and let it sit in the fridge for the bread to absorb the dressing.

Farro is an ancient grain with a chewy texture that works perfectly in make-ahead salads.

Roast your favorite vegetables—like carrots, Brussels sprouts, and squash—and toss them with cooked farro.

A drizzle of lemon and olive oil completes this hearty, nutritious salad.
